ຮຽນຮູ້ວິທີທີ່ຈະກາຍເປັນນັກພັດທະນາ iOS

ການເພີ່ມຂຶ້ນປະມານ 12,5% ຂອງຕະຫລາດລະບົບປະຕິບັດການຂອງໂທລະສັບສະຫຼາດໃນເດືອນພະຈິກ 2016, ການພັດທະນາ iOS ຍັງມີຫຼາຍໃນລະດັບຄວາມຕ້ອງການທີ່ມີຄວາມຕ້ອງການ, ດ້ວຍບໍລິສັດຈໍານວນຫນຶ່ງທີ່ສ້າງແຜນພັດທະນາມືຖືຂອງຕົນເອງເພື່ອຮັກສາຄວາມຕ້ອງການຂອງຕະຫຼາດ. ຖ້າທ່ານສົນໃຈກັບກາຍເປັນຜູ້ພັດທະນາ iOS, ນີ້ແມ່ນຄໍາແນະນໍາກ່ຽວກັບວິທີທີ່ທ່ານສາມາດເລີ່ມຕົ້ນໄດ້.

ຮຽນຮູ້ Objective-C

Objective-C ແມ່ນພາສາການຂຽນໂປລແກລມມາດຕະຖານສໍາລັບຜະລິດຕະພັນ iOS ແລະ OSX, ຕາມລໍາດັບ.

ມີຫຼາຍໆຊັບພະຍາກອນທີ່ທ່ານສາມາດຮຽນຮູ້ເພີ່ມເຕີມກ່ຽວກັບມັນ, ເຊັ່ນ: ຫັດຖະກໍາຂອງໂຮງຮຽນ Code ທີ່ເຮັດໃຫ້ການຮຽນຮູ້ພື້ນຖານ Objective-C ເປັນເກມທີ່ສົມບູນແບບ. ແນ່ນອນ, ນີ້ແມ່ນສະຖານທີ່ທໍາອິດທີ່ທ່ານຄວນເລີ່ມຕົ້ນຖ້າທ່ານສົນໃຈກັບກາຍເປັນຜູ້ພັດທະນາ iOS.

Swift ແມ່ນອະນາຄົດ

ດ້ວຍການປ່ອຍ Swift ໃນປີ 2014, ທ່ານອາດຄິດວ່າການຮຽນຮູ້ Objective-C ອາດຈະບໍ່ຄຸ້ມຄ່າເວລາຂອງທ່ານ. ບໍ່ດັ່ງນັ້ນໄວ, ເຖິງແມ່ນວ່າ, Roadfire Software ແນະນໍາໃຫ້ທ່ານເຂົ້າໃຈຕົວເອງກັບທັງສອງຢ່າງ, ໂດຍສະເພາະນັບຕັ້ງແຕ່ Swift ບໍ່ໄດ້ຖືກທົດແທນຢ່າງເຕັມສ່ວນ Objective-C ພຽງແຕ່:

"... ທ່ານຈໍາເປັນຕ້ອງຮູ້ວ່າ Swift ຫຼື Objective-C (ຮູ້ ທັງສອງ ຈະດີທີ່ສຸດ). ສໍາລັບຕໍາແຫນ່ງໃນລະດັບຕໍາ່, ທ່ານຄວນຮູ້ຢ່າງໄວວາ syntax ແລະການຕົກລົງທີ່ດີຂອງໂຄງການພື້ນຖານ (ວັດຖຸ, ການເກັບກູ້, ປະເພດຂໍ້ມູນ, ເຄືອຂ່າຍ, JSON). ນອກເຫນືອໄປຈາກນີ້, ທ່ານຈໍາເປັນຕ້ອງຮູ້ແນວຄວາມຄິດວັດຖຸພື້ນຖານພື້ນຖານເຊັ່ນ: ສິ່ງທີ່ເປັນວັດຖຸ, ສິ່ງທີ່ຊັ້ນຮຽນແລະວິທີການຂຽນວິທີການ. "

Treehouse ມີຫຼັກສູດ Swift ທີ່ທ່ານສາມາດເບິ່ງຕົວຢ່າງຖ້າທ່ານສົນໃຈໃນການຮຽນຮູ້ເພີ່ມເຕີມ.

ປະຕິບັດ!

ໃນປັດຈຸບັນທີ່ທ່ານໄດ້ເຂົ້າໃຈຕົວເອງກັບ Objective-C ຫຼື Swift (ຫຼືບາງທີອາດມີ), ທ່ານຄວນຈະປະຕິບັດຫຼາຍເທົ່າທີ່ເປັນໄປໄດ້. ສ້າງແອັບຯຂອງທ່ານເອງ, ໃຫ້ເຂົາເຈົ້າລົງໃນ App Store, ປັບໂຕໃຫ້ຫຼາຍເທົ່າທີ່ເປັນໄປໄດ້. ນີ້ແມ່ນວິທີທີ່ດີທີ່ສຸດທີ່ຈະເຂົ້າໃຈຕົວເອງກັບທຸກສິ່ງທີ່ຜູ້ພັດທະນາ iOS ຕ້ອງການຮູ້ກ່ຽວກັບການອອກແບບແລະການບໍາລຸງຮັກສາ app.

ມັນຍັງເຮັດໃຫ້ຄວາມສາມາດລະຫັດຂອງທ່ານເຂັ້ມແຂງ, ເຊິ່ງມັນກໍ່ເປັນເງິນທີ່ດີ.

ເປັນສ່ວນຫນຶ່ງຂອງຊຸມຊົນ

GitHub ແມ່ນຫນຶ່ງໃນຊຸມຊົນທີ່ມີລະຫັດທີ່ໃຫຍ່ທີ່ສຸດໃນໂລກ. ມັນສະເຫນີປະຫວັດຂອງສະບັບແລະຊຸມຊົນຂະຫນາດໃຫຍ່ທີ່ສາມາດຊ່ວຍໃຫ້ທ່ານພ້ອມກັບການທົດສອບແອັບຯແລະໂຄງການຂອງທ່ານ. ໃຜກໍ່ຕາມທີ່ມີຄວາມສົນໃຈໃນການເຮັດວຽກທີ່ມີລະຫັດການນໍາໃຊ້ GitHub, ແລະທີ່ຄວນເປັນເຫດຜົນພຽງພໍສໍາລັບທ່ານທີ່ຈະໃຊ້ມັນ. ແຕ່ມັນຍັງສາມາດຊ່ວຍເຫຼືອໄດ້ຫລາຍຖ້າວ່າທ່ານຕິດຢູ່ກັບບັນຫາທີ່ທ່ານບໍ່ແນ່ໃຈວ່າຈະແກ້ໄຂແນວໃດ.

ອາສາສະຫມັກບໍລິການຂອງທ່ານ

ວິທີການທີ່ດີທີ່ຈະໄດ້ຮັບຊິ້ນສ່ວນຫຼັກຊັບແລະປະສົບການທີ່ແທ້ຈິງຂອງໂລກແມ່ນການອາສາສະຫມັກບໍລິການຂອງທ່ານໃຫ້ແກ່ທຸລະກິດທີ່ບໍ່ແມ່ນກໍາໄລແລະທຸລະກິດທ້ອງຖິ່ນ. ແນ່ນອນ, ທ່ານຈະບໍ່ສ້າງລາຍໄດ້, ແຕ່ວ່າທ່ານຈະສ້າງລາຍຊື່ຜູ້ຕິດຕໍ່ແລະເອກະສານທີ່ມີຄວາມສໍາຄັນໃນການເຮັດວຽກໃດຫນຶ່ງ, ໂດຍສະເພາະໃນການພັດທະນາ iOS.

ໃນຖານະເປັນ Andrew G Rosen ຂຽນ:

"ກົນລະຍຸດຂອງທ່ານໄດ້ຮັບການອ້າງອິງທີ່ຫນ້າສົນໃຈຫຼາຍເທົ່າກັບຄວາມສາມາດຂອງນັກພັດທະນາ iOS ຂອງທ່ານ, ແລະສະແດງຄວາມສາມາດໃນການພົວພັນສາທາລະນະ." ສະແດງໃຫ້ເຫັນວ່ານາຍຈ້າງທີ່ທ່ານສາມາດສົ່ງເສີມຕົວເອງແລະພົວພັນກັບລູກຄ້າແມ່ນສໍາຄັນ.

ສະຫຼຸບ

ມີຫຼາຍສິ່ງອື່ນໆທີ່ທ່ານສາມາດເຮັດໄດ້ເພື່ອເລີ່ມຕົ້ນການເປັນຜູ້ພັດທະນາ iOS, ແຕ່ຄໍາແນະນໍາເຫລົ່ານີ້ແນ່ນອນວ່າສໍາຄັນຖ້າທ່ານມີຄວາມຕັ້ງໃຈເລີ່ມຕົ້ນການເຮັດວຽກໃນສະຫນາມ. ຮຽນຮູ້ຫຼາຍເທົ່າທີ່ທ່ານສາມາດເຮັດໄດ້ກ່ຽວກັບທຸກສິ່ງທຸກຢ່າງທີ່ຕ້ອງຮູ້ກ່ຽວກັບການພັດທະນາ iOS ແລະທ່ານແນ່ນອນວ່າທ່ານຈະເປັນຜູ້ພັດທະນາໃນເວລາບໍ່ດົນມານີ້.